Understanding Skin Cancer Cells: A Short Review



Skin cancer cells, a prevalent and possibly dangerous ailment, begins as an aberration in the skin cells. This problem is mainly driven by DNA damage, typically as a result of too much direct exposure to dangerous ultraviolet (UV) radiation from the sunlight or fabricated sources like tanning beds. This damages lead to unchecked cell development, forming a mass of cancerous cells. There are three main sorts of skin cancer cells: basal cell cancer, squamous cell carcinoma, and the extra dangerous melanoma. While the previous 2 are highly treatable and much less most likely to spread, cancer malignancy is known for its aggression and propensity to technique. Early discovery is crucial to successful therapy, making routine skin assessments an important preventative step.

Comprehending the Mohs Procedure



While several may not recognize with the term, Mohs surgical procedure is a precise medical technique mostly utilized in the treatment of skin cancer. Called after Dr. Frederic Mohs that created the treatment, it includes the elimination of slim layers of skin, one by one, until only cancer-free tissue stays. Each layer is taken a look at under a microscopic lense for cancer cells right away after removal. This method ensures the optimum conservation of healthy and balanced cells. The specialist, that is frequently a skin doctor, is learnt both surgical procedure and pathology, permitting for the instant and precise analysis of the cells. This special element of Mohs surgery significantly boosts the possibilities of complete cancer cells removal and reduces the demand for extra treatments or treatments.

Possible Dangers of Mohs



Despite its countless advantages, it is very important to recognize that Mohs surgery, like any kind of other clinical procedure, includes its very own set of possible dangers. These might include infection, blood loss, and possible sensitive responses to the regional anesthetic. There may additionally be a chance of nerve damages, resulting in short-lived or long-term pins and needles near the medical area. Furthermore, as with any type of surgery, there is a threat of scarring. While the micrographic nature of Mohs surgery lessens this risk, it is not totally eliminated. It's likewise crucial to note that sometimes, the cancer may not be totally removed, requiring more therapy. As with any type of skin surgical procedure, there's a little threat of the cancer persisting.

Preparing for Mohs Surgical Procedure



Before undergoing Mohs surgery, precise preparation is critical for a smooth treatment and effective outcome. These preparations begin with a detailed conversation with the dermatologist about the patient's case history, allergies, and existing drugs. Particular drugs might need to be stopped briefly or adjusted, particularly those affecting blood clot. People need to additionally be notified regarding the potential threats and advantages of the surgical procedure.


On the day of the treatment, individuals are encouraged to eat a regular morning meal unless instructed or else. Comfortable apparel is suggested, and clients need to plan to bring a book or comparable product for home entertainment throughout waiting periods. It needs to be noted that the treatment can last a number of hours, relying on the complexity of the instance.

The Performance and Success Rate of Mohs Surgery



Often proclaimed as one of the most effective therapies for skin cancer cells, the success rate of Mohs surgical procedure is certainly impressive. Researches show that for Source key basal cell cancer, the most usual type of skin cancer cells, Mohs surgical treatment flaunts a five-year remedy rate of as much as 99%. For squamous cell cancer, an additional common skin cancer, the success price is around 94%. Mohs surgery owes its efficiency to its special method of getting rid of malignant cells layer by layer, examining each under a microscope until no traces of cancer continue to be. This careful method reduces damage to healthy cells and decreases the opportunity of cancer cells recurrence, making Mohs surgical procedure an optimal option for treating skin cancer.
